The $3 billion Randolph-Brooks Federal Credit Union has beennamed the Small Business Administration's top 7(a) program lenderin the small lending category.

|

The Live Oak, Texas-based credit union began offering SBA loansin 2006. In 2008, RBFCU made more than 200 SBA loans, according tothe agency. While the SBA does not have a credit union lender ofthe year award, RBFCU will be the only credit union being honoredat next week's National Small Business Week's recognitionactivities, said Carol Chastang, an SBA spokeswoman.

|

The SBA said it is recognizing financial institutions "for acombination of factors, most saliently financial assistanceprovided, whether in the form of loans, investments, surety bonds,and their continued commitment to and support for small businessduring a time of economic upheaval and credit shortages."

|

Kenan Pankau, business services lending manager at RBFCU, willbe in Washington next week to accept the SBA award.

|

Compass Bank in Birmingham, Ala. has been named the SBA's top7(a) program lender in the large lender category.
